Looking at the comparisons you've given, it seems almost like a DMB replay. Does the OOTP replay still create, for example, some star players who were mediocre in real life (or vice versa)? Not monster players who were cut short by injury in real life, but Doug Dascenzos who, through the magic of talent increases, end their careers with 3000 hits?
Not very often will this happen with the recalculate mode. You will get some far outperform real life such as Royals pitcher Melido Perez (78-85 real life vs 177-137 this sim). Perez is probably not the best example but one I noticed from my last post on Kansas City.

For lack of a better phrase the recalculate mode can be considered very close to DMB type replays. I call it the Hall of Fame mode because it delivers far more realistic career paths. However, the old or if you prefer 'Classic' mode is still available and it will give you a chance to have a Cliff Markle (see my sig) type player develop.

I would expect most solo replayers will use the recalculate option but online leagues may greatly prefer the classic mode because of the unpredictability or randomness of career development.

To me, it gives the user the best of both worlds and allows you to play the way you want to.
